You’ve seen it—floors or panels that look like wood, but feel a little different. No knots, no splinters, no warping over time. It looks familiar, yet not quite. So what do you call it? This “fake wood” actually goes by a few names—each revealing a bit more about what it really is.
Most people call it Wood-Plastic Composite, or WPC—a kind of engineered wood with a plastic backbone.
But it goes by a few other names too: composite wood, synthetic timber, plastic lumber. Different labels, same idea—wood’s look, with a little extra resilience built in.

Not heat-resistant
Here’s the trade-off, quietly tucked beneath the surface. Fake plastic wood doesn’t love heat. Push it past 70°C for too long, and it starts to soften, losing that crisp, solid feel. It’s reliable in everyday settings—but in high-heat zones, it asks for a bit of respect.
Laser cutting is not possible
Not all tricks are allowed. WPC can bend, plane, and drill—but laser cutting? That’s off the menu. Its composition resists the beam, reminding you that even the most versatile materials have their “don’t try this at home” moments.
Lacks the natural texture of wood
WPC wears its limits on the surface. It mimics wood but can’t capture that authentic grain feel, and its exterior shows wear more easily—scratches sneak in where real timber would age gracefully. Beauty with a soft edge.

Property | Solid Wood | Fake Plastic Wood (WPC / Plastic‑Wood Composite) |
Strength & Structural Performance | Generally, higher tensile and flexural strength and load‑bearing capability; strong natural fibres resist impact. | Good mechanical properties, but typically lower stiffness and load capacity compared with solid wood; may require support under heavy loads. |
Durability & Weather Resistance | Can last decades with proper care, but it is sensitive to moisture, cracking, warping, and UV degradation. | Highly resistant to rot, decay, moisture, and many weather conditions, with longer service life and less maintenance. |
Maintenance | Requires regular maintenance (oiling, sealing); refinishing is possible if damaged. | Low maintenance; no painting/staining needed; simple cleaning sufficient; limited repairability if damaged. |
Aesthetics & Texture | Unique natural grain and warmth; often seen as more desirable. | Can mimic wood aesthetics but often lacks the natural grain and feel of real wood. |
Cost | Typically higher upfront cost; a long lifespan can make it cost‑effective over time. | Higher initial cost than basic timber in some markets; often lower long‑term maintenance cost. |
Environmental Impact | Renewable and biodegradable when sustainably sourced; stores carbon; minimal synthetic chemicals. | Often uses recycled materials, is resource efficient, but the plastic component is non‑biodegradable, and recycling is complex. |
Moisture & Stability | Prone to swelling/shrinkage with humidity changes. | Dimensionally stable with low moisture absorption; resists warping. |
Repairability | Can be sanded, refinished, and repaired. | Harder to repair; damage often requires replacement. |

Q1: What is fake wood made of?
A1: Fake wood like Wood‑Plastic Composite (WPC) is an engineered blend of wood fibres and thermoplastics (think recycled plastics like PE or PVC), combined with additives to make a sturdy, wood‑look material you can use for decking, cladding, and more.
Q2: Is WPC better than real wood?
A2: Better depends on what you need: WPC won’t rot, warp, or get eaten by bugs the way traditional wood can, and it requires much less upkeep—so for busy spaces and long life, WPC often wins.
Q3: Does plastic wood look realistic?
A3: Yes! Modern composites are moulded and textured to mimic real wood grain and colour beautifully, giving that warm, natural look without the common quirks of timber.
Q4: Is composite wood waterproof?
A4: WPC is highly water‑resistant and handles moisture far better than raw wood, making it ideal for damp spots—but like any material, extreme or prolonged exposure can test its limits.
Q5: How long does WPC last?
A5: With quality materials and proper installation, WPC decks and boards can last 20–30 years or more, outliving many untreated wood options with far less maintenance.
